Why Airlines Avoid Direct Flights Between Myrtle Beach and Chicago

Several factors influence why airlines don’t offer direct flights between Myrtle Beach and Chicago. These include:

  • Passenger Demand: Airlines need enough travelers to fill a flight profitably. The demand between Myrtle Beach and Chicago may not be high enough year-round.

  • Competition and Hub Strategy: Chicago O’Hare (ORD) is a major hub for United Airlines and American Airlines. These airlines prefer routing passengers through their hubs with connecting flights rather than offering direct routes from smaller airports.

  • Operational Costs: Running direct flights requires resources like aircraft availability and crew. Airlines often prioritize routes with higher revenue potential.

  • Seasonality: Myrtle Beach sees more visitors in summer. Airlines may offer seasonal direct flights to some cities but not consistently to Chicago.

Nearby Airports with Direct Flights to Chicago

If you want to avoid connections, consider airports near Myrtle Beach that offer direct flights to Chicago. These airports include:

  • Charleston International Airport (CHS): About 100 miles southwest of Myrtle Beach, Charleston offers several direct flights to Chicago O’Hare, mainly on American and United Airlines.

  • Raleigh-Durham International Airport (RDU): Around 150 miles from Myrtle Beach, RDU has many direct flights to Chicago on multiple airlines.

  • Greenville-Spartanburg International Airport (GSP): Approximately 90 miles northwest, GSP offers some direct flights to Chicago, though less frequent.

Driving or taking a shuttle to one of these airports can save you time and hassle if you prefer nonstop flights.

Best Airlines and Routes for Traveling Between Myrtle Beach and Chicago

Since direct flights are rare, most travelers use connecting flights. Here’s how to find the best options:

  • American Airlines: Connects through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T), a major hub close to Myrtle Beach.

  • United Airlines: Routes through Washington Dulles (IAD) or Newark (EWR) to Chicago O’Hare.

  • Delta Air Lines: Connects via Atlanta (ATL), a large hub with many daily flights to Chicago.

  • Allegiant Air: Offers seasonal direct flights to some destinations but not currently to Chicago.

Booking flights with one connection in these hubs usually results in the shortest travel time.
